New name and location for Batesville business
Magnolia Finance – formerly Treasurer Loans – held a Ribbon Cutting on Thursday, April 25, to celebrate the new name and location at 660 Hwy. 6E, across from Hardee’s. Owners and staff were joined by Batesville officials for the event sponsored by Panola Partnership and its Ambassadors. Hernando approves hotel and retail development at McIngvale and Green T
Hernando has approved a new 25 acre development located next to I-269 that will feature retail and restaurant sites along with three new upscale hotels. Ironwood, which will be built at the strategic corner of McIngvale and Green T Road at Exit 1 along the interstate, will have three branded hotels by Marriott, a convenience store with 12 fuel pumps, a multi-bay retail site for six tenants, and five restaurant spaces.
